The 70th annual conference of the German Communication Association (DGPuK) will be held between March 19 and 21, 2025 and is organized by the Institute for Media and Communication Studies at Freie Universität Berlin and the Weizenbaum Institute for the Networked Society. The conference topic is “Öffentlichkeit(en) und ihre Werte” [Public Spheres and Their Values].

Several HBI researchers will be at the venue with their own presentations or participating in panels.
